Designer

Greater London Permanent Up to £40000.00 per annum

We have partnered with a unique business who are looking for a Designer to join their London team. They will be responsible for creating compelling and visually striking designs and animations that showcase the brand’s exhibitions and projects.

This will involve utilizing a deep understanding of visual design principles and staying up-to-date on the latest trends and technologies.

The Designer will need to be able to multitask and prioritize their workload effectively, as the schedule will be full and require working on material for multiple exhibitions, print editions, and NFT drops simultaneously. They will need to be able to work collaboratively with other teams and stakeholders, ensuring that all design work is aligned with the brand’s overall vision and message.

The successful candidate will need to have a good knowledge of UX and always keep in mind the audience for whom the assets are being created, ensuring that they are engaging and encourage the desired action.
